We couldn’t wait to tryout the new arrival in the family of super charged Mazdas. Rumours swelled around the coming of the Speed, notably the possible addition of all-wheel drive. It ends up, probably for monetary reasons, being a traction product, which sets it apart from The Mazda 6 though it shares the same 2.3 litres turbocharged engine. One could safely say that 263hp is quite a load for a vehicle of this size and traction.
